Organization Profile
Ten Thousand Villages
http://www.alexandria.tenthousandvillages.comTo create opportunities for artisans in developing countries to earn income by bringing their products and stories to our markets through long-term fair trading relationships.
International Service
Families
Alexandria, VA, 22314